North Court Street Infrastructure Improvements Project
This project consists of replacing the existing storm tunnel under North Court Street (located near Fern Alley), reconstructing the brick pavement on North Court Street from Carpenter Street to Fern Alley, and repairing sections of the existing storm sewer. The project also includes select sidewalk repairs on East State Street, Grosvenor Street, Franklin Street and Morris Avenue.
During the remainder of this week York Paving Company will continue installing the new storm tunnel; the City water crew is also expected to complete work to a waterline in the work zone.
York Paving Company expects to complete the installation of the new tunnel by early next week. Once the tunnel is installed they will begin work installing a catch basin and junction box near Cornwell Jeweler's. Columbia Gas is also expected to complete their work in this area next week. Preparation for the remainder of the bricklaying work is also expected to begin in the east lane.
During this construction period, North Court Street will be closed to vehicle traffic from Rose Alley to Carpenter Street - a marked detour will be maintained for the duration of the project. There will also be times during the project that will require the temporary closure of either the east or west sidewalk adjacent to North Court Street to protect pedestrians from construction activities. During these times a sidewalk detour will be marked and maintained.
Businesses between West State Street and Carpenter Street will remain open during the project, according to their individual schedules.
